Pakistan, July 10 -- The Oil and Gas Regulatory Authority (OGRA) has launched the second phase of its flagship initiative - Digitising Pakistan's Oil supply chain.

Building on the successful deployment of its online licensing system and the first phase of digitisation, OGRA has now initiated a comprehensive Track & Trace system in collaboration with the Punjab Information Technology Board (PITB).

This next phase aimed to enhance transparency, operational efficiency, and safety across the country's downstream oil sector.
